Royal Caribbean's Ultimate World Cruise, launching in December 2023, sets a new record as the longest cruise offered by a mainstream commercial cruise line. This remarkable journey spans 274 nights and takes passengers to over 60 countries across seven continents.

 

The cruise promises an unparalleled experience, visiting eight of the "World's Wonders," such as the Great Wall of China, Iguazú Falls, Machu Picchu, Christ the Redeemer, Chichén Itzá, The Colosseum, The Taj Mahal, and the Great Barrier Reef.

 

Embarking on the Serenade of the Seas, a Radiance-class ship with a capacity for 2,100 passengers, travelers have the flexibility to book segments of the journey or embark on the entire global itinerary.

 

The adventure begins with the Ultimate Americas Cruise, starting in Los Angeles and including stops in Hawaii and French Polynesia. It then transitions to the Ultimate Asia Pacific Cruise, covering destinations like Australia, Indonesia, the Philippines, Hong Kong, Japan, and India.

 

The journey continues with the Ultimate Africa and Southern Europe leg, departing from Dubai and visiting the Seychelles, Madagascar, South Africa, Namibia, Ghana, Canary Islands, Italy, Slovenia, and Croatia. The final segment, Ultimate Europe and Beyond, features multiple stops in Spain, Morocco, Portugal, Denmark, Latvia, Germany, Iceland, Newfoundland, New York, and the Bahamas.

 

Onboard the Serenade of the Seas, guests can enjoy 12 dining options, multiple bars and lounges, three swimming pools, a rock climbing wall, a mini-golf course, and a basketball court. The main dining room offers "world-class" cuisine, while the Windjammer Cafe serves global dishes and American favorites.

 

For those seeking relaxation, the Vitality at Sea Spa provides a range of treatments. Fitness enthusiasts can stay active in the state-of-the-art fitness center, ensuring they don't miss a workout during their voyage.
